Tharaka-Nithi County, located in the eastern region, has a population of 0.39 million people with an average income of KES 42,000 per month. Tharaka-Nithi County has good access to both traditional banks and digital lenders.
Tharaka-Nithi residents primarily access financial services through mobile money (M-Pesa), agency banking, and local microfinance institutions. Digital lenders are increasingly popular.

Mobile money and digital lenders work best in Tharaka-Nithi for amounts under KES 100K.
If you don't have formal payslips, use M-Pesa statements showing regular income. Many Tharaka-Nithi lenders accept this for self-employed borrowers.
If you can't access a branch, use agency banking points throughout Tharaka-Nithi for account opening and document submission.
Start with small mobile money loans (M-Shwari, Fuliza) and repay on time. This builds your CRB credit score for larger KES 10,000 loans later.
